Retirement is changing fast, and for many Australians the idea of simply stopping work at 65 no longer reflects reality.

So what does modern retirement look like, and how much money do you really need to be comfortable?

On this episode of the Friends With Money podcast, Money's Vanessa Walker is joined by journalist and author Nina Hendy to discuss the new retirement landscape, the rise of FORO (fear of running out), and the practical steps Australians can take to build financial confidence in later life.
